Details

EA_OnOutputItemClicked events inform Add-Ins that the user has clicked on a list entry in the system tab or one of the user defined output tabs.

Usually an Add-In responds to this event in order to capture activity on an output tab they had previously created through a call to Repository.AddTab().

Note that every loaded Add-In receives this event for every click on an output tab in Enterprise Architect - irrespective of whether the Add-In created that tab. Add-Ins should therefore check the TabName parameter supplied by this event to ensure that they are not responding to other Add-Ins' events.

Also look at EA_OnOutputItemDoubleClicked.

Syntax

EA_OnOutputItemClicked(Repository As EA.Repository, TabName As String, LineText As String, ID As Long)

The EA_OnOutputItemClicked function syntax has the following elements:

Parameter

Type

Direction

Description

ID

Long

IN

The ID value specified in the original call to Repository.WriteOutput().

LineText

String

IN

The text that had been supplied as the String parameter in the original call to Repository.WriteOutput().

Repository

EA.Repository

IN

An EA.Repository object representing the currently open Enterprise Architect model. Poll its members to retrieve model data and user interface status information.

TabName

String

IN

The name of the tab that the click occurred in. Usually this would have been created through Repository.AddTab().

Return Value

None.
